Transferring Video Recordings
You can transfer recordings to a computer using the HDV/DV terminal.
(10)
Equipment and System Requirements
A computer equipped with an IEEE1394 (DV) terminal or an IEEE1394 (DV) capture board
A DV cable (commercially available)
Video editing software
The appropriate driver
The standard of the video transferred depends on the standard of the original recording and the compatibility of the video editing software.

IMPORTANT
The video transfer may not work correctly depending on the software and the specifications/settings of your computer.
If the computer freezes while the camcorder is connected to it, disconnect the DV cable and turn off the camcorder and the computer. After a
short while, turn them on again, set the
camcorder to mode and restore the connection.
Before connecting the camcorder to the computer using a DV cable, make sure that the camcorder and computer are not connected with a USB cable, and that no other IEEE1394 device is connected to the computer.
